The Lagos State government has made it known that access from the service lane into Ikorodu Road at the Ojota Loop inward Ikorodu has been closed.
The Nation reports that access from the highway into the service lane is equally closed.
According to The Nation, a statement by Director, Public Affairs, Ministry of Transportation, Biola Fagunwa, said the initiative was to manage traffic along the axis and maximise the gains of various traffic management strategies adopted.
“All those intending to link the Lagos-Ibadan Expressway are to take their journey through the service lane to link up at the Loop.
“There are exits into the service lane just after Ojota Garage and after the pedestrian bridges along the Ikorodu bound traffic.
“Traffic control personnel and appropriate signs have been installed. We urge motorists to partner with them to ensure free flow of traffic,” the statement said.
The statement said motorists, especially commercial bus operators, must restrict their activities to the service lanes and ensure that they use designated bus stops.
